Froedtert South Computed Tomography (Ct) Technologist - Riii in Pleasant Prairie, United States

Computed Tomography (Ct) Technologist - Riii

Froedtert South Pleasant Prairie, WI (Onsite) Part-Time

Apply on company site

Job Details

  • POSITION PURPOSE

  • Under the supervision of a radiologist, performs all CT scans in accordance with department policies and procedures

Operates auxiliary equipment including, but not limited to: laser camera, processor, magnetic tape/optical disk, and power injector, administers intravenous and oral contrast materials as dictated by scan protocols, assists with providing technical coverage 24 hours per day, seven (7) days per week.

  • MINIMUM EDUCATION REQUIRED

  • Associate Degree: Graduate of an accredited certification program in Radiologic Technology

  • MINIMUM EXPERIENCE REQUIRED

  • Entry Level

  • LICENSES / CERTIFICATIONS REQUIRED

  • Licensure to be eligible to practice as a Licensed Radiographer in the State of Wisconsin

  • American Registry of Radiologic Technologist (A.R.R.T.) - CT registered

  • Current BLS and/or CPR certification from the American Heart Association or American Red Cross or the ability to obtain certification within 6 weeks of hire.

  • K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ES REQUIRED

  • Knowledge of cross-sectional anatomy preferred.

  • Basic computer knowledge helpful.

  • Ability to read, write, hear, speak and comprehend the English language fluently.

  • PRINCIPLE ACCOUNTABILITIES AND ESSENTIAL DUTIES

  • Operates all CT and ancillary equipment associated with the performance of routine and special CT procedures; responsible for radiation safety; has the ability to recognize and report equipment malfunctions; follows maintenance protocols at all times to ensure maximum equipment performance and minimize down time

Proficiency in the use of all software upgrades is required.

  • Utilizes proper CT and positioning techniques to maximize film quality and minimize the need for additional scans

Must be able to move patients on stretchers, in wheelchairs and on CT table

Must appropriately label radiographs, document pertinent clinical information and use independent judgment to determine steps necessary to complete each study

Must be able to perform intravenous injections of contrast material according to examination protocols.

  • Must assist with the 24 hours per day, seven (7) days per week CT department coverage as needed.

  • Assists radiologist and other physicians with special CT procedures, including biopsies; exam room is set up according to department/physician protocols; sterile technique is required; pre-procedures questionnaires/ consent forms are complete and accurate.

  • Receives and records verbal orders from licensed independent practitioners for orders that are specific to the services provided by their department.

  • Administers medications in a timely manner, safely and in accordance with policy and procedure.
